Forty-three million people are uninsured in America. Nearly 50 percent of the uninsured live in the suburbs and have an average annual income of $50,000 or less. These individuals/families do not usually qualify for any insurance programs offered by the government and may not have coverage as they are either self-employed and cannot afford the cost or are working in places where such benefits are not provided.

Chicagoland-based Compassionate Care Network (CCN) is intended for individuals who do not have insurance. CCN offers an individual membership for $30 or a $60 family membership for 6 months. This is renewable. There is also a $25 flat fee per office visit per patient. CCN also offers free health screenings at various locations.
